Q1
If for some \(\alpha\) and \(\beta\) in \(R\), the intersection of the following three planes
\[
\begin{aligned}
& x+4 y-2 z=1 \\
& x+7 y-5 z=\beta \\
& x+5 y+\alpha z=5
\end{aligned}
\] is a line in \(R ^3\), then \(\alpha+\beta\) is equal to :
[JEE Main 2020, 9 Jan (Shift 1)]
